Blue Hands, Brown Skin is a powerful debut poetry collection about belonging, loss, migration, and the quiet resilience of women who carry entire homelands in their bodies. Moving between Kenya and Berlin, these poems explore how migration reshapes a life and what it means to grieve far from home, to navigate love and language across borders, and to return to oneself after being broken open by the world. Through storytelling and intimate lyricism, the poet examines how the body remembers what history tries to erase—from girlhood rituals and ancestral wisdom to the bureaucratic coldness of immigration lines and the loneliness of diaspora. Each poem becomes an altar to survival, a place where memory, motherhood, and identity meet. What makes this collection distinctive is its fusion of personal narrative with cultural myth, its fearless attention to the spiritual and emotional worlds of African women, and its insistence that softness, even in exile, is a form of strength. Blue Hands, Brown Skin is a testament to how we carry home within us, in our grief, in our names, and in the stories that refuse to be burned.
